Immigration

I am extremely concerned about the rapidly growing problem of illegal immigration. The thousands of immigrants that pour into our country illegally each year continue to drain precious resources from both the federal and state governments, and the numbers of legal immigrants have reached unmanageable levels. I regularly support and cosponsor legislation designed to place reasonable curbs on illegal immigration. For example, during the past several Congresses, I have been a cosponsor of legislation which would restrict immigration to the United States to spouses and children of U.S. citizens, family-sponsored immigrants, employment-based immigrants, and refugees. In July, I voted for a Supplemental Appropriations bill which provides $500 million to hire, train, and equip an additional 500 border patrol agents.

I also believe that it is essential for those who have legally come to the United States to be able to speak the English language. By establishing English as the official language immigrants will be better-equipped to achieve success in their new home, and the bond between immigrants and those already living in the United States will grow stronger. I am pleased to inform you that I have signed on as a cosponsor of the English Language Unity Act of 2005, which will establish English as the official language of the United States.
